Djidji is a town in southern Ivory Coast.
It is a sub-prefecture of Lakota Department in Lôh-Djiboua Region, Gôh-Djiboua District.
Djidji was a commune until March 2012, when it became one of 1126 communes nationwide that were abolished.
[2] In 2014, the population of the sub-prefecture of Djidji was 12,375.
